commit 586f4a6468c6962265e48674194d4f602870563c Author: Wieczorek Bartosz Date: Wed Jan 18 09:40:32 2017 +0100 initial repo structure di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..fab7372 --- /dev/null +++ b/.gitignore @@ -0,0 +1,73 @@ +# This file is used to ignore files which are generated +# ---------------------------------------------------------------------------- + +*~ +*.autosave +*.a +*.core +*.moc +*.o +*.obj +*.orig +*.rej +*.so +*.so.* +*_pch.h.cpp +*_resource.rc +*.qm +.#* +*.*# +core +!core/ +tags +.DS_Store +.directory +*.debug +Makefile* +*.prl +*.app +moc_*.cpp +ui_*.h +qrc_*.cpp +Thumbs.db +*.res +*.rc +/.qmake.cache +/.qmake.stash + +# qtcreator generated files +*.pro.user* + +# xemacs temporary files +*.flc + +# Vim temporary files +.*.swp + +# Visual Studio generated files +*.ib_pdb_index +*.idb +*.ilk +*.pdb +*.sln +*.suo +*.vcproj +*vcproj.*.*.user +*.ncb +*.sdf +*.opensdf +*.vcxproj +*vcxproj.* + +# MinGW generated files +*.Debug +*.Release + +# Python byte code +*.pyc + +# Binaries +# -------- +*.dll +*.exe + diff --git a/CMakeLists.txt b/CMakeLists.txt new file mode 100644 index 0000000..400ad55 --- /dev/null +++ b/CMakeLists.txt @@ -0,0 +1,4 @@ +cmake_minimum_required(VERSION 2.8) + +project(eedb) +add_executable(${PROJECT_NAME} "main.cpp") diff --git a/CMakeLists.txt.user b/CMakeLists.txt.user new file mode 100644 index 0000000..e95a322 --- /dev/null +++ b/CMakeLists.txt.user @@ -0,0 +1,956 @@ + + + + + + EnvironmentId + {16e47ff4-5a57-423d-b2bd-70f884db1c66} + + + ProjectExplorer.Project.ActiveTarget + 0 + + + ProjectExplorer.Project.EditorSettings + + true + false + true + + Cpp + + CppGlobal + + + + QmlJS + + QmlJSGlobal + + + 2 + UTF-8 + false + 4 + false + 80 + true + true + 1 + true + false + 0 + true + true + 0 + 8 + true + 1 + true + true + false + false + + + + ProjectExplorer.Project.PluginSettings + + + + ProjectExplorer.Project.Target.0 + + GCC6 + GCC6 + {4a2180cc-3e19-4a04-98f7-740914a4ed65} + 0 + 0 + 0 + + + /home/bwieczor/src/__BUILDS__/eedb-GCC6-Domyślna +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Domyślna + Domyślna +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=Debug + + /home/bwieczor/src/__BUILDS__/eedb-GCC6-Debug +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Debug + Debug +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=Release + + /home/bwieczor/src/__BUILDS__/eedb-GCC6-Release +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Release + Release +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=RelWithDebInfo + + /home/bwieczor/src/__BUILDS__/eedb-GCC6-Wersja z informacją debugową +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Wersja z informacją debugową + Wersja z informacją debugową +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=MinSizeRel + + /home/bwieczor/src/__BUILDS__/eedb-GCC6-Wersja o minimalnym rozmiarze (kosztem prędkości) +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Wersja o minimalnym rozmiarze (kosztem prędkości) + Wersja o minimalnym rozmiarze (kosztem prędkości) + CMakeProjectManager.CMakeBuildConfiguration + + 5 + + + 0 + instalacji + + ProjectExplorer.BuildSteps.Deploy + + 1 + Zainstaluj lokalnie + + ProjectExplorer.DefaultDeployConfiguration + + 1 + + + + false + false + false + false + true + 0.01 + 10 + true + 1 + 25 + + 1 + true + false + true + valgrind + + 0 + 1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10 + 11 + 12 + 13 + 14 + + -1 + + + + %{buildDir} + Własny plik wykonywalny + + ProjectExplorer.CustomExecutableRunConfiguration + 3768 + false + true + false + false + true + + 1 + + + + ProjectExplorer.Project.Target.1 + + G++ 4.9 (x86 64bit in /usr/bin) Qt 5.6.1 dla System + G++ 4.9 (x86 64bit in /usr/bin) Qt 5.6.1 dla System + {602cff39-296a-4766-9f33-4598f11014c8} + 0 + 0 + 0 + + + /home/bwieczor/src/__BUILDS__/eedb-G_4_9_x86_64bit_in_usr_bin_Qt_5_6_1_dla_System-Domyślna +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Domyślna + Domyślna +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=Debug + + /home/bwieczor/src/__BUILDS__/eedb-G_4_9_x86_64bit_in_usr_bin_Qt_5_6_1_dla_System-Debug +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Debug + Debug +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=Release + + /home/bwieczor/src/__BUILDS__/eedb-G_4_9_x86_64bit_in_usr_bin_Qt_5_6_1_dla_System-Release +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Release + Release +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=RelWithDebInfo + + /home/bwieczor/src/__BUILDS__/eedb-G_4_9_x86_64bit_in_usr_bin_Qt_5_6_1_dla_System-Wersja z informacją debugową +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Wersja z informacją debugową + Wersja z informacją debugową +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=MinSizeRel + + /home/bwieczor/src/__BUILDS__/eedb-G_4_9_x86_64bit_in_usr_bin_Qt_5_6_1_dla_System-Wersja o minimalnym rozmiarze (kosztem prędkości) +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Wersja o minimalnym rozmiarze (kosztem prędkości) + Wersja o minimalnym rozmiarze (kosztem prędkości) + CMakeProjectManager.CMakeBuildConfiguration + + 5 + + + 0 + instalacji + + ProjectExplorer.BuildSteps.Deploy + + 1 + Zainstaluj lokalnie + + ProjectExplorer.DefaultDeployConfiguration + + 1 + + + + false + false + false + false + true + 0.01 + 10 + true + 1 + 25 + + 1 + true + false + true + valgrind + + 0 + 1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10 + 11 + 12 + 13 + 14 + + -1 + + + + %{buildDir} + Własny plik wykonywalny + + ProjectExplorer.CustomExecutableRunConfiguration + 3768 + false + true + false + false + true + + 1 + + + + ProjectExplorer.Project.Target.2 + + Clang 3.9 + Clang 3.9 + {2e62a059-0116-4322-b158-5f8f59318894} + 0 + 0 + 0 + + + /home/bwieczor/src/__BUILDS__/eedb-Clang_3_9-Domyślna +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Domyślna + Domyślna +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=Debug + + /home/bwieczor/src/__BUILDS__/eedb-Clang_3_9-Debug +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Debug + Debug +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=Release + + /home/bwieczor/src/__BUILDS__/eedb-Clang_3_9-Release +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Release + Release +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=RelWithDebInfo + + /home/bwieczor/src/__BUILDS__/eedb-Clang_3_9-Wersja z informacją debugową +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Wersja z informacją debugową + Wersja z informacją debugową + CMakeProjectManager.CMakeBuildConfiguration + + + + CMAKE_BUILD_TYPE:STRING=MinSizeRel + + /home/bwieczor/src/__BUILDS__/eedb-Clang_3_9-Wersja o minimalnym rozmiarze (kosztem prędkości) + + + + + + + true + Make + + CMakeProjectManager.MakeStep + + 1 + budowania + + ProjectExplorer.BuildSteps.Build + + + + + + clean + + true + Make + + CMakeProjectManager.MakeStep + + 1 + czyszczenia + + ProjectExplorer.BuildSteps.Clean + + 2 + false + + Wersja o minimalnym rozmiarze (kosztem prędkości) + Wersja o minimalnym rozmiarze (kosztem prędkości) + CMakeProjectManager.CMakeBuildConfiguration + + 5 + + + 0 + instalacji + + ProjectExplorer.BuildSteps.Deploy + + 1 + Zainstaluj lokalnie + + ProjectExplorer.DefaultDeployConfiguration + + 1 + + + + false + false + false + false + true + 0.01 + 10 + true + 1 + 25 + + 1 + true + false + true + valgrind + + 0 + 1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9 + 10 + 11 + 12 + 13 + 14 + + -1 + + + + %{buildDir} + Własny plik wykonywalny + + ProjectExplorer.CustomExecutableRunConfiguration + 3768 + false + true + false + false + true + + 1 + + + + ProjectExplorer.Project.TargetCount + 3 + + + ProjectExplorer.Project.Updater.FileVersion + 18 + + + Version + 18 + + diff --git a/bin/eedb.sh b/bin/eedb.sh new file mode 100644 index 0000000..e69de29 diff --git a/share/CMakeLists.txt b/share/CMakeLists.txt new file mode 100644 index 0000000..e69de29 di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t new file mode 100644 index 0000000..e69de29 diff --git a/src/app/CMakeLists.txt b/src/app/CMakeLists.txt new file mode 100644 index 0000000..e69de29 diff --git a/src/app/main.cpp b/src/app/main.cpp new file mode 100644 index 0000000..e69de29 diff --git a/src/eedb/CMakeLists.txt b/src/eedb/CMakeLists.txt new file mode 100644 index 0000000..e69de29 diff --git a/tests/CMakeLists.txt b/tests/CMakeLists.txt new file mode 100644 index 0000000..e69de29